Аналогичный метод в формате РПГУ Отправка данных о заявке на прохождение диспансеризации РПГУ
POST: {{url}}/api/v2/disp/{{lpuGuid}} |
Параметр | Тип | Описание | По умолчанию | Обязательный | Комментарий |
---|---|---|---|---|---|
lpuGuid | path | Гуид ЛПУ | - | + |
список токенов создан для удобства, лишние токены удалить
Заголовок | Значение (тип/формат значения) | Описание | Обязательный |
---|---|---|---|
Authorization | Bearer {lpuToken} (без скобок и через пробел после Bearer) | LPU токен, полученный с помощью сервиса авторизации | + |
Поле | Тип данных | Описание | Обязательный | Комментарий |
---|---|---|---|---|
Exam_id | string(Guid) | Гуид типа диспансеризации | + | |
Day_visit | string (DateTime) | Дата начала прохождения диспансеризации | + | |
string | E-mail пациента | - | ||
Questions | array of QuestionItem | Список ответов на вопросы | - | Не является обязательным при создании заявки. Для части типов диспансеризации является обязательным:
Если не будет указан, то анкета не будет заполнена в карте. |
{ "exam_id": "1DEC26C7-13A2-4DAF-8C2C-38E33619C82E", "day_visit": "2019-06-06", "email": "patient@email.ru", "questions": [{ "QuestionID": 13, "AnswerID": 24, "AnswerType": "Choise", "AnswerName": "нет" }, { "QuestionID": 14, "AnswerID": 26, "AnswerType": "input", "AnswerName": "рак желудка" } ] } |
В случае успешного выполнения сервер вернет ответ c кодом 200
Код ответа сервера | Код сообщения | Сообщение | Тип ошибки |
---|---|---|---|
HTTP код ответа | MessageCode | Text | Validation/Error |
В случае возникновения ошибок будет возвращен стандартный ответ сервера.